I think there are substantial differences between a non-standard extension, and what we would need for the K210. First, the changes we would need are for the official specification. At the time this chip was designed, this was *the* authritative privileged spec. I think if a hardware vendor makes the effort to comply with the specification as it exists at the time, then we should support that. In addition, the incompatibilities are within the core boot process. Most non-standard extensions will be optional extras which can be completely ignored. For example, the GAP8 processor has a non-standard extension which adds some instructions for complex number arithmetic (and other operations). These instructions have no effect on the usual boot process, and (if there was an MMU) Linux could run fine on that board with no knowledge of these extensions. Lastly, these non-standard instructions can be documented in a standard way through the isa version string. Hopefully that will not happen, but I think given the long development period of the vector spec, it is inevitable that a chip will be released with some subtle (or not-so-subtle) incompatibilities. As far as I can tell, the restriction on non-ratified extensions is to prevent work towards experimental specifications which may never have real hardware which uses them. However, I think if real hardware is incompatible small but fundamental way, then we should make the effort to support it, especially when the patches already exist. --Sean
